Player: Freddie Dilione
Class: 2022
School: Trinity Christian

Recruitment Update:

One player that really could be on the verge of seeing a big uptick in his recruitment is 2022 Freddie Dilione from Trinity Christian.  He has been regarded as one of the top players in the state of North Carolina but it seemed odd that schools were coming his way with an offer.  That eventually changed though, as he earned his first offer from Eastern Kentucky and then FIU.  After that, he received offers from Penn State, Houston, North Carolina A&T, and Xavier

It certainly was an exciting time when he earned his first Power-5 offer from Penn State.

“Oh, that was a great offer,” he told Phenom Hoops when asked about his thoughts on the offer from the Nittany Lions.  “They are in the Big 10, so a lot of exposure out there but they just talk about how they love my size and feel for the game and how I can score the ball at any given moment. It was great; I was hype!”

He also earned an offer from Houston, a Top-25 program that has targeted several players in North Carolina in the past.

“That was a big one as well, I think they are ranked in the Top 10 right now.  I was very excited when I got that one, they are such a good team with a very smart coach.  They want me to score the ball and rebound every possession.”

The latest offer though came from Xavier, a program that has been showing interest his way for some time now.  But now, they pulled the trigger and now gives Dilione yet another offer.

“My thought was like, dang, I just was offered by Xavier, a big-time school.  They were talking very highly of me and I just had to thank God for blessing me once again.”

With four offers on the table now, Dilione also mentioned that schools like Tulsa, NC State, and Providence have all expressed interest as well; they could be the next to enter in his recruitment.
